Received a Letter from M" Cumming informing us that 1778 Sept. 14. a Report prevails in her Neighbourhood that a Party of Rangers are coming that Way to apprehend disaffected Persons and secure their Property and as Mf Cumming is confined in Goal for Disaffection is apprehensive they may disturb her and her Family and take away their Property Ordered that this Board grant a Protection to the said M" Cumming and that all Officers both Civil and Milatary & all other Persons whatsoever be strictly enjoyned and forbid not [169] to molest the said M" Cumming or Family either in Person or Property on Pain of being prosecuted with the utmost Severity of the Law -- Then Adjourned till to Morrow Morning

Met pursuant to Adjournment -- Albany I5 Sept 1778 -- l h ; r Sept. 15. Present

John M. Beekman ) j Isaac D. Fonda Mathew Visscher ) ( Petrus Wynkoop Jun^

It having appeared to us by the Information of Nathaniel Morgan that Johan George Fought and Coenradt Johnson were knowing to the Robberies committed by the said Nathaniel Morgan and others Ordered that they be severally cited to appear before the Board on the Eighteenth Day of September Instant -- Mathew Aerson laid before the Board his Account for ferrying across the River Capf John Ryley and the Company of Rangers under his Command at different Times amounting to £8^17^4 ordered that the same be paid -- 1
